Vote for your local hero...

Birmingham City Council's 'Local Hero' Award recognises the work of council staff who provide excellent customer care. If you have benefitted from such a service, please let us know.

The nominate member of staff could work in any department of the council. They may be a helpful neighbourhood advisor, a friendly librarian, a conscientious park keeper, a favourite carer, a hospitable housing officer or star teacher.

The nominee may have 'saved the day' by helping you out of a difficult situation, given a consistently high standard of service over a long period of time or just put a smile on your face and made your day.

Funding Opportunities

Community Chest

For 2012/13 all wards in the city receive a Community Chest allocation of £100,000. This allocation enables the wards to fund schemes which support ward and neighbourhood working or contribute to extending community engagement, cohesion and empowerment.

Projects supported through this fund must also demonstrate that they support one or more of the outcomes in Birmingham's Council Plan 2008-2013 and Birmingham's Community Strategy 2026.

Generally, any properly constituted organisation may submit a project proposal. You should first talk with the District Ward Support Officer, to find out about what outcomes and locally identified priorities the Ward or District Committee is likely to support and the money that it has available. Contact Salim Miah on 0121 675 0768 or by email at salim.s.miah@birmingham.gov.uk.

Community First

The Community First Programme is a national programme which runs over four years until 2015. Twenty-seven wards in Birmingham have funding through Community First. The programme is independent of Birmingham City Council and is managed by a national organisation, appointed by the Government, called Community Development Foundation. Community First funding is distributed by a Community First Panel established in the Ward. A list of Community First Panels along with other information about this programme and how to access funding is available on the Community Development Foundation Website.

There may be a number of other funding opportunities available, such as Big Lottery Funding, Sport England, Community Matters and others. Your District Ward Support Officer can give you more information on this.
